    About

    None of the households in Mission Canyon, CA reported speaking a non-English language at home as their primary shared language. This does not consider the potential multi-lingual nature of households, but only the primary self-reported language spoken by all members of the household.

    95.3% of the residents in Mission Canyon, CA are U.S. citizens.

    In 2024, the median property value in Mission Canyon, CA was $2M, and the homeownership rate was 71.1%.

    Most people in Mission Canyon, CA drove alone to work, and the average commute time was 14.2 minutes. The average car ownership in Mission Canyon, CA was 2 cars per household.

    Housing & Living

    The median property value in Mission Canyon, CA was $2M in 2024, which is 6.01 times larger than the national average of $332,700. Between 2023 and 2024 the median property value increased from $1.89M to $2M, a 5.77% increase. The homeownership rate in Mission Canyon, CA is 71.1%, which is higher than the national average of 65.2%.

    People in Mission Canyon, CA have an average commute time of 14.2 minutes, and they drove alone to work. Car ownership in Mission Canyon, CA is approximately the same as the national average, with an average of 2 cars per household.

    Poverty & Diversity

    5.58% of the population for whom poverty status is determined in Mission Canyon, CA (128 out of 2.3k people) live below the poverty line, a number that is lower than the national average of 12.5%. The largest demographic living in poverty are Females 45 - 54, followed by Females 18 - 24 and then Females 65 - 74.

    The most common racial or ethnic group living below the poverty line in Mission Canyon, CA is Hispanic, followed by Two Or More and White.

    The Census Bureau uses a set of money income thresholds that vary by family size and composition to determine who classifies as impoverished. If a family's total income is less than the family's threshold than that family and every individual in it is considered to be living in poverty.
